Regulated and Unregulated Sites

In much of the world, casino gaming for real money is legal, regulated and taxed. This includes protection for players via the licensing process. The best casinos are often parts of companies who are listed on major stock markets in London – adding another layer of financial oversight via accounting rules.

Unfortunately, the US has made banking transactions between casinos and domestics banks illegal. This has forced those casinos still welcoming US players offshore. Countries like Netherlands Antilles are happy to license casinos, though there would be little recourse for the average US citizen in the case of a dispute.

This makes ensuring that your casino has a good reputation more important than ever for US-based players. There are some excellent brands that have a very good track record in offering safe gaming and reliable cash-outs. There are also many new names popping up who do not yet have that kind of reputation.

Is It Safe to Deposit?

Again we need to make a distinction between regulated worldwide casinos and offshore US-friendly places. In much of the world you will have access to a wide range of deposit options including credit or debit cards, eWallets and bank transfers. For anyone concerned about using their credit card, eWallets (electronic wallets) are a great solution. These provide a buffer between your bank and the casino site. These will also allow you to move your bankroll around quickly – for example to take advantage of bonus offers.

In regulated environments you have a great chance of getting your money back through the financial authorities should something go wrong. This adds a layer of security to your online casino experience.

For US players, there are still come deposit methods open to get your money safely on board. Visa credit cards have a great track record via their ability to make international purchases. If you are concerned about the safety of using your card, then Money Transfer services are a viable and 100% safe alternative.

You can withdraw from online casinos either via paper check, or the Money Transfer services. Checks do face delays for cutting, posting and then clearing at your bank. While Money Transfer withdrawals can be with you in just a few days. The speed and safety of your withdrawal really depends more on the casino than the method being employed. Make sure you stay with the larger and more reputable brands, many of whom have very solid reputations for processing withdrawals in a timely manner.

Are The Games Rigged?

The answer here is simple: casino games have a built in house edge. As such, casinos really don’t need to rig any games in their favor. The human brain is well designed for seeing patterns, and we can spot unusual losing sequences very quickly. Statistically, these are just noise, with the real profit defined by the house edge.

To make sure your casino is as safe as possible, you should check for external certification of their random number generation software. This should be prominently displayed on their website, together with contact information including a phone number. If any of this is missing, then find another casino.

Can I Be Sent To Court For Gambling Online?

No, nobody in the US has ever been indicted on any charges relating to playing real money casino games online. Currently only the banks and payment processors are covered federally, with some States having statutes which make online gambling a misdemeanor. A court case involving an individual player would test laws which the Federal agencies seem reluctant to set any court precedent on – adding an extra layer of security for those players happy to exercise their right to gamble online.
